Women's Lacrosse Slide Slips to Five-Straight as Lions Suffer 19-7 Regional Home Loss to Millersville

Lakewood, N.J. - After an opening day victory over Molloy College back on Feb. 20, Georgian Court University has yet to return to the win column as the Lions suffered their fifth-straight setback Tuesday with a 19-7 home loss to Millersville University in women's lacrosse regional action.

The win puts the visiting Marauders at a perfect 3-0 to start the campaign while GCU drops to 1-5 with the defeat. Leading 9-5 at intermission, Millersville dominated the second stanza, 10-2, and closed out contest with six-straight tallies. 

Six Marauders netted two or more goals in the triumph, paced by Kristi Kada (Jr.-Gilberstville, Pa.) and her five scores. Grace Cobaugh (Sr.-Collegeville, Pa.) and Amanda Juliano (Sr.-Garnet Valley, Pa.) authored five-point performances with three goals and two assists apiece. Gillian Zimmerman (Gr.-New Park, Pa.) contributed a four-goal effort for Millersville.

Heather Devaney and Riley O'Connor each recorded a pair of goals for the home team. Isabel Raimondi provided a goal and a helper. Millersville dominated the shot column, 38-21, with a hefty advantage on frame (29-12).

Alexis Hahn did all she could to keep GCU in the game as the junior gathered 10 saves in the Lions' net. Morgan Scott (Fr.-New Oxford, Pa.) earned the win for Millersville (five saves).

The Lions look to snap its slide this Saturday with an 11:00 a.m. home contest vs. #22 University of New Haven.
